Key differences

  • ESPO costs 0.07% less per year.
  • ESPO is significantly larger than GGME — larger funds tend to be more liquid and less likely to close.
  • Over the last 3 years, GGME has delivered higher annualized returns.
  • GGME has a longer track record, which may reduce uncertainty around long-term behavior.
